Cozy Cream Sweater with Relaxed Denim

This outfit embodies the essence of transitional dressing. The cream-colored sweater provides warmth and sophistication, while the light-wash, slightly distressed jeans maintain the laid-back summer feel. Brown leather accessories—like a structured handbag and ankle boots—introduce autumnal hues, bridging the seasonal gap effortlessly.

This combination is perfect for crisp early fall days when you want to look polished without compromising comfort. The relaxed denim keeps the outfit casual, while the cozy sweater adds a hint of luxury. Complete the look with oversized sunglasses and minimal jewelry for a chic, effortless vibe.

Cozy Knit and Wide-Leg Trouser Combo

Oversized pale yellow knit sweaters paired with navy wide-leg trousers strike a beautiful balance between summer lightness and fall warmth. The knit adds a soft, cozy texture, while the trousers maintain a tailored silhouette suitable for both casual and office settings.

Adding cognac leather accessories, such as a structured tote and classic loafers, ties the look together with rich, seasonal tones. This outfit demonstrates how color, texture, and proportion can work together to make a seamless transition between seasons while remaining polished and stylish.

Sleeveless Sweater and Distressed Jeans

For fluctuating temperatures, a sleeveless beige ribbed sweater is ideal. It offers warmth without causing overheating and pairs beautifully with light-wash distressed jeans. Structured tan handbags add sophistication, while oversized sunglasses maintain a touch of summer glamour.

Barely-there sandals keep the look breathable, making this ensemble perfect for early fall afternoons. This outfit showcases how to combine summer staples with autumn-ready pieces for practical, stylish transitional dressing.

Floral Maxi Dress with Leather Jacket

A long floral maxi dress paired with a black leather jacket bridges the gap between romantic summer vibes and edgy autumn style. Rich floral prints in purples and blues provide seasonal versatility, while gold jewelry adds understated sophistication.

Layering a jacket over airy summer dresses is a classic transitional strategy, allowing for flexibility in unpredictable weather and creating a visually appealing contrast between soft fabrics and structured outerwear.

Floral Maxi with Autumn Leather

Breezy white floral maxi dresses can transition into fall with caramel-colored leather jackets and matching suede boots. This pairing combines summer lightness with autumnal warmth, extending the life of favorite summer pieces while ensuring comfort as temperatures dip.

Structured jackets introduce a polished edge to flowing dresses, creating a balanced silhouette that is both feminine and practical for the changing season.
